#38e632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38e632 is composed of 22% red, 90.2%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 118 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#38e632 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ff64 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#38e632 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38e632 has RGB values of R:56, G:230,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 3728946.

Shades and Tints of #38e632
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#38e632
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8e8a is the less saturated color, while #27f820 is the most saturated one.
